Notice has been issued by the Central Consumer Protection Authority i.e. CCPA to other companies including Amazon and Flipkart and it has been said that they should remove the Pakistani flags and the goods there.

Baycott Pak’s campaign intensified

The CCPA says that selling Pakistan goods and its flag on e-commerce sites is openly a violation of laws related to sales. In such a situation, it should be removed immediately. Consumer Affairs Minister Prahlad Joshi, while posting on his ex account, has instructed to remove it immediately.

He has written in his post that notice has been sent by the government to e-commerce platforms. He has written in it that these insensitive things will not be tolerated and all e-commerce companies have been instructed to follow the laws of the country.

Campaigned against Pakistan’s friend Turkey

A similar campaign is also going on in the country against Türkiye, which supports Pakistan. In India, people are now not only by boys for Turki goods, but are also avoiding traveling there. Along with this, they are also appealing to tourism. The Turki Boycuts are calling at the time that a record number of Indian tourists were going there.

It is worth noting that the number of Indian tourists going to Turki in the year 2009 was 55 thousand, which increased to 2 lakh 30 thousand in 2019 after ten years. Last year i.e. in 2024, the number of Turkas from India had increased to 3 lakh 30 thousand 985. Praveen Khandelwal, general secretary of the traders’ organization Confederation of All India Traders (CAT) and MP from Chandni Chowk Lok Sabha seat, says that the journey boycott can have a very bad effect on the economy of Turkey and Azerbaijan. Especially the tourism sector there will be damaged.
